ZIP code 71944 is a sparsely populated 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Grannis, Polk County, Arkansas, home to just 773 residents across 108.9 square miles, a density of 7 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.

ZIP 71944 lands in the middle-income range, with a median household income of $75,893 (34% above the average Arkansas ZIP), while per-capita income is $26,545. The poverty rate is 10.4%, with unemployment at 0.5%; those measures add context to the income figure. Home values sit below the statewide ZIP benchmark: the median is $84,300 (42% below the average Arkansas ZIP), and median rent is $880; owner occupancy is 82.9%.

Formal educational attainment runs low here: just 8.8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 32.2, and the average commute is -.
